The Academy International School is a dynamic centre of education. We are constantly evolving in response to the changing necessities of the students and reflecting the global environment. We follow an holistic approach to education. Our strong belief in education in the broadest sense permeates all our teaching and learning. While providing the students with a very high form of academia we also encourage the students in their development of the necessary life skills to become responsible, compassionate and successful citizens of the world.
At The Academy International School we have combined the beauty of our natural surroundings in the heart of the Mallorcan countryside with modern facilities and up to date resources to create an environment which is extremely conducive to learning.
The school was opened in 1985 with 25 children and two teachers. It originally started up as a Summer School which, due to its success, carried on as a school in September 1985.
Now there are 310 students ranging in age from 2 to 16. The students follow the British National Curriculum which incorporates a wide spectrum of subjects and topics and pupils can continue their education up to IGCSE examination level.
The main language of instruction is English. Spanish lessons begin in Reception 1 and Catalan lessons commence in Year 2. The students in Key Stage 2 can choose to study another modern foreign language, German or French.
The majority of the students are Spanish, British or German. However, there are students from each of the continents. This international representation gives the students a global perspective and allows for the promotion of a rich cultural experience. Many activities throughout the school year provide the children with the opportunity to share and learn from each other in an environment that promotes learning as a partnership between teachers, parents, children and the community as a whole.
The teaching staff is 90% British and the remaining teachers represent other English speaking countries or form the Department of Modern Foreign Languages.
The school is inspected regularly both by British Inspectors and Inspectors from the Spanish Ministry of Education, Culture and Sports.
We have also been awarded the quality certificate ISO 9001 and annual inspections recognize the consistently high quality of our service in education.
